Spacious Accommodations and Home Comforts

Key Features of Condo Rentals

Condos typically offer significantly more space than standard hotel rooms. According to a report by the American Resort Development Association, the average condo rental provides about 1,050 square feet of space, compared to the average hotel room's 325 square feet. This extra space includes multiple bedrooms, a living area, and often more than one bathroom, making it ideal for families or groups.

Home-Like Amenities Include:

  • Fully equipped kitchens
  • In-unit washers and dryers
  • Separate living and sleeping areas
  • Private balconies or patios

These amenities not only enhance comfort but also add a layer of convenience that can lead to a more relaxed and personalized vacation experience.

Strategic Locations and Direct Access

One of the standout advantages of many condo rentals, especially those in coastal areas, is their prime location. Direct beach access is a common feature, eliminating the hassle of long commutes to and from the beach and the inconvenience of transporting beach gear. This proximity allows guests to freely move between the beach and their temporary home, maximizing their time spent enjoying the natural surroundings.

Economic Advantages of Staying In

Cost-Effectiveness of Eating In

Having a kitchen can significantly reduce vacation expenses.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ics notes that the average American household spends about $3,000 annually on dining out. By utilizing a condo's kitchen, travelers can save on food costs, which is particularly beneficial for extended stays. The ability to prepare meals in a relaxed, private setting also caters to families with dietary restrictions or preferences, adding another layer of convenience.

Additional Savings

  • No daily parking fees: Many condos include free parking, which is often not the case with hotels, especially in popular tourist destinations.
  • Reduced rates for longer stays: Condos often offer discounts for weekly or monthly rentals, which can be more economical than nightly hotel rates.

Privacy and a Personalized Experience

Renting a condo can enhance the sense of privacy during a vacation. Without the constant presence of hotel staff and other guests, families and couples can enjoy a more intimate and undisturbed experience. This privacy also extends to amenities such as pools or fitness centers, which, if available in the condo complex, are typically less crowded than those in hotels.
